

Today, developer Bandai Namco Studios Inc. and publisher Bandai Namco Entertainment have released a gameplay trailer for the newly addition to the roster Fahkumram to Tekken 8, a fighting game. Fahkumram will be available for players to play as on July 7th for those who purchase the Season 2 pass, and available for the rest of the players on July 10th. According to an article from DualShockers, there will be server downtime around 6:30 PDT before the patch download becomes available. Once the game comes back online, players will only be able to play offline modes which will give players time to train in playing Fahkumram. For other players who are interested in Tekken 8, the game is available on PC through Steam, PlayStation 5, and the Xbox Series X/S.
The gameplay trailer shows Fahkumram, a returning character from Tekken 7, enter the fight and the trailer also shows different combos and abilities he will have in the game for players to create fighting techniques with. He fights against three different fighters throughout the trailer and the combos become more and more intense as the trailer continues on, showing off more of his abilities.
At the very end of the trailer, they preview Fahkumram’s four new cosmetic skins as well as the Season 2 character and Stage Pass, but the rest of what is to come in Season 2 will be announced later in the fall and winter according to the trailer.
According to a new post on the Steam page, there will also be balance adjustments, Ghost Showdowns, a Karate Kid Legends collaboration, and PAC-MAN stage and items will be added into the game. According to another article made by EventHubs, Bandai Namco have also revealed that Armor King, another returning character from Tekken 7, will be the next DLC character that will be released later in the fall after Fahkumram.
